Hiking around Cheniménil provides access to a network of trails traversing the forested valleys and hills of the Vosges region. The landscape is characterized by dense woodlands, river systems, and occasional rocky outcrops, offering varied terrain for outdoor activities. Elevation changes are present throughout the area, contributing to diverse hiking experiences.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Cheniménil?

There are over 140 hiking trails in the Cheniménil area, offering a wide range of options for different skill levels and preferences. You'll find everything from easy strolls to more challenging ascents through the Vosges landscape.

Are there easy hiking trails suitable for beginners or families in Cheniménil?

Yes, Cheniménil offers more than 50 easy hiking trails perfect for beginners or families. An excellent option is The great Douglas – Roche Goutteuse loop from La Baffe, an easy 3.5-mile (5.7 km) path that winds through the forest and passes notable rock formations.

What kind of natural attractions can I expect to see on hikes near Cheniménil?

The region is known for its beautiful natural features. You can discover impressive waterfalls like the Great Tendon Waterfall and the Little Waterfall of Tendon. Many trails also feature dense woodlands, river systems, and unique rock formations such as the Sandstone boulders at Les Archettes.

Are there any circular hiking routes in Cheniménil?

Yes, many of the trails around Cheniménil are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. A popular choice is the Great Tendon Waterfall – View of Tenon. loop from Col de la Bijoire, which is a longer, more challenging route with panoramic views.

What is the best time of year to go hiking in Cheniménil?

The best time to hike in Cheniménil is generally from spring through autumn (April to October) when the weather is mild and the trails are clear. Spring brings lush greenery, while autumn offers vibrant fall foliage. Summer is also popular, but trails can be busier.

Can I go hiking in Cheniménil during winter?

Winter hiking is possible in Cheniménil, but conditions can vary. Some trails may be covered in snow or ice, especially at higher elevations. It's advisable to check local weather forecasts and trail conditions before heading out and to wear appropriate winter hiking gear.

Are there any hikes with good viewpoints in the Cheniménil area?

Yes, the varied terrain of the Vosges region around Cheniménil offers several opportunities for scenic views. For example, the Great Tendon Waterfall – View of Tenon. loop from Col de la Bijoire includes panoramic vistas. You can also seek out specific viewpoints like the View from La Brostille (862 m).

What do other hikers say about the trails in Cheniménil?

The hiking routes in Cheniménil are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.5 stars from over 1,500 reviews. Hikers often praise the quiet woodlands, the well-maintained paths, and the diverse natural beauty, including waterfalls and unique rock formations.

Are there any moderate hiking trails for those looking for a bit more challenge?

Absolutely. Cheniménil has nearly 80 moderate trails. The Nice restaurant – Forest Path loop from Docelles is a popular moderate option, covering about 9.9 miles (16.0 km) through varied forest terrain.

Is it possible to spot wildlife while hiking in Cheniménil?

The dense forests and natural habitats around Cheniménil provide opportunities for wildlife spotting. Keep an eye out for local birds, deer, and other forest animals, especially during quieter times of the day like early morning or late afternoon.

Where can I find parking for hiking trails in Cheniménil?

Many trailheads and popular starting points around Cheniménil, especially those near villages or specific attractions, offer designated parking areas. It's often helpful to check the tour details on komoot for specific parking information related to your chosen route.

Are dogs allowed on the hiking trails in Cheniménil?

Generally, dogs are welcome on most hiking trails in the Cheniménil area, provided they are kept on a leash and owners clean up after them. It's always a good idea to check specific trail regulations or local signage, especially in protected natural areas.
